Yad 0.16 - Eu quero sempre mais de ti
Neste artigo pretendo mostrar as novidades que vieram com a última versão estável do Yad. Faço uma cobertura mais completa dessa fantástica ferramenta, além de colocar exemplos úteis, comentando as possibilidades que podem ser implementadas.
[ Hits: 85.574 ]
Por: Raimundo Alves Portela em 07/01/2012 | Blog: http://portelanet.com
100
#!/bin/bash # Exemplo útil usando o display main() { yad --title='Aviso' --display=':0' \ --image='preferences-system-time' --text='Vai durmir cara!' \ --button='Só mais um pouco':1 --button='Ok':0 case $? in 1) MIN=$( yad --entry --title='Adiar' --entry-label='Minutos' --entry-text='10' --numeric 0 59 1 --display=':0') # se clicar em OK agenda um novo horário usando o at [ $? -eq 0 ] && TEMPO=$(date --date "now +${MIN%%.*} min" | egrep -o '[0-9]{2}:[0-9]{2}') && at "$TEMPO" -f "$0" && exit # se clicar em CANCEL carrega a tela inicial novamente main ;; 252|0) exit ;; esac } main
Apresentando o Yad - "zenity melhorado"
Consultas SQL pelo Terminal no Postgres, Mysql, SQL Server, etc
Enviar e-mail pelo terminal com mutt
StarDict - software de tradução de ótima qualidade!
Explorando a entrada de dados com READ em Bash Shell
pam_mount e CiD - Gerenciamento centralizado dos mapeamentos de unidades de rede no Ubuntu
Desligar servidores quando o nobreak entra na bateria e envio de aviso por e-mail
Como programar backup com rsync e cron de maneira rápida e simples
Piano Gripe 3 - Caracteres de controle
Aprenda a Gerenciar Permissões de Arquivos no Linux
Como transformar um áudio em vídeo com efeito de forma de onda (wave form)
Como aprovar Pull Requests em seu repositório Github via linha de comando
Quebra de linha na data e hora no Linux Mint
Organizando seus PDF com o Zotero
tentando instalar em um notebook antigo o Linux LegacyOS_2023... [RESO... (9)
Problema com Conexão Outlook via Firewall (OpenSUSE) com Internet Fibr... (5)